Fan-out in Notably is pull-based: workers drain the Hopsail queue and apply per-tenant rate caps. If backpressure alarms fire, check consumer lag before scaling workers—usually one tenant is flooding. Contractors get read access to the lag dashboard through the Notably proxy. The proxy requires an auth token, and the next line sets it.

vault entry, kafog-yahop: COURIER_KEY8=0faa53ae

Ticket: Staging env misconfigured for Siftgate bloom filter

The bloom layer in front of the Pellet KV store is rejecting all lookups in staging because the env file was copied from the dev template without credentials. False-positive tuning values are fine; only the auth line is missing. To unblock the weekly demo, the Pellet admission secret must be set on the following line.

env line for yaguf-fajop: LEDGER_TOKEN13=fb08984397349

Subject: Badge system migration — night shift

Hi all,

As of Monday, Quayside Mills is moving from the old Lattermark readers to the new Veyron panels. Your current badges will stop working on the night doors once the switch happens mid-shift. Replacement badges are in named envelopes at the front desk — collect yours before 22:00. If a panel fails during the changeover, use the fallback code below.

badge for tawip-hagug: bdg-JAZUYR-57471969